The Developmental Support Assistant (formally Educational Assistant) works with the learning team to provide a variety of support, such as growth, development, and educational based the child's assessment and consultation. This is for children experiencing difficulties in social, developmental, communication, physical, play, and overall preschool skills development. The Developmental Support Assistant reports directly to the Coordinating Teacher who is a member of the learning team.

The Developmental Support Assistant works with a learning team (Coordinating Teacher, SLP, OT, PT) and helps to deliver services to multiple children in their respective programs.

**D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ES**
- Support children in daily activities and social interactions.
- Work together as a team, to ensure the child’s individual goals and objectives are being met.
- Meet with the Coordinating Teacher, therapists (learning team) involved with the child.
- Integrate feedback, suggestions, or recommendations regarding the child made by learning team.
- Attend **mandatory** team meetings and training sessions.
- Maintain required documentation daily.
- May, on occasion, tend to various needs of the children (diapering, toileting, medical needs) when required.
